Biography
Sharmila Tagore (born December 8, 1944) is an Indian actress known for her work in Hindi and Bengali cinema. Regarded among the greatest actresses in the history of Indian cinema, she has been a recipient of multiple accolades, including a Filmfare Lifetime Achievement Award and a Padma Bhushan, India's third highest civilian honour.
